For those of y’all who shoot street on film, do you take the time to record the basic “EXIF” data for each shot? If available, do you put a data back in your camera? Basic “EXIF” data would include camera, lens & setting if a zoom, ISO, aperture, shutter speed. It seems that this would be useful info to have and disruptive to the street environment at the same time. I appreciate your input.
While I do think that information would be interesting to have I usually shoot in a "target rich environment." And for the most part I work with either a Nikon F4 or a Canon EOS 650 both with zoom lens, set for the most part for as close to auto as possible. I do this because I'm concentrating on the next shot and have been known to stand with camera at my eye waiting to see if my anticipated shot materializes, or not.
So while I'd like to have that information, I'm not going to take time to collect it.
